高效视频编码技术标准及其演化

合集下载

视频编解码技术简介

视频编解码技术简介

视频编解码技术简介第一节:什么是视频编解码技术视频编解码技术(Video Codec)是一种将视频信号进行压缩和解压缩的技术。

它通过降低视频信号数据的冗余性来减少数据传输或存储所需的带宽或存储空间,从而实现高效的视频传输和存储。

在视频编码过程中,先对视频信号进行压缩,而在解码过程中则对压缩后的视频信号进行还原。

第二节:视频编解码技术的发展历程视频编解码技术的发展经历了多个阶段。

早期的视频编解码技术采用的是无损压缩的方法,即完全保留原始图像信息,但需要大量的存储空间和传输带宽。

后来,随着互联网的发展,压缩编码技术逐渐成为主流。

目前常用的视频编解码技术包括MPEG、、等。

第三节:常见的视频编解码标准1. MPEG(Moving Picture Experts Group)编码标准是一种广泛应用于视频压缩的技术。

它将视频信号分解成一系列帧,并通过空间和时间的冗余性来实现压缩。

MPEG编解码标准包括了MPEG-1、MPEG-2、MPEG-4等多个版本,其中MPEG-4是应用最为广泛的一个版本。

2. (也称为AVC)是一种高效的视频编解码标准。

它在视频质量和压缩比之间取得了良好的平衡,适用于各种应用场景,如视频会议、网络视频等。

采用了许多新的编码技术,如运动预测、帧内预测和熵编码,以提高压缩效率。

3. (也称为HEVC)是的后继标准,是目前最先进的视频编解码技术之一。

在的基础上进行了改进,充分利用了高级分析和新的压缩算法。

相较于,可以实现更高的压缩效率,即在相同的视频质量下,更少的数据量和带宽需求。

第四节:视频编解码技术的应用领域视频编解码技术广泛应用于各个领域。

在互联网应用中,视频编解码技术使得视频的在线播放更加流畅,减少了带宽需求,并提供了更好的用户体验。

在视频会议和远程协作中,视频编解码技术使得远程通信更加便捷,实现了高清画质和低延迟。

此外,视频编解码技术还应用于电视广播、监控系统、医学影像和虚拟现实等领域。

视频编码算法分析

视频编码算法分析

视频编码算法分析视频编码算法是一种将视频信号压缩的技术。

通过对视频信号进行压缩,可以减少数据传输所需的带宽,并使视频在传输和存储过程中占用更少的空间。

本文将对常见的视频编码算法进行分析,包括H.264、HEVC和AV1。

一、H.264编码算法H.264是一种广泛应用的视频编码算法,也被称为高级视频编码(Advanced Video Coding,简称AVC)。

它采用了一系列先进的压缩技术,包括帧内预测、帧间预测、运动估计、变换编码和熵编码等。

在H.264编码中,帧内预测通过在当前帧中寻找与之前已编码帧相似的像素块来减小冗余信息。

帧间预测则利用帧内预测的结果和运动向量进行帧间像素块的预测,从而进一步减小冗余。

运动估计是H.264编码的关键技术之一。

它通过对相邻帧进行运动检测和估计,找到最佳的运动向量来描述帧间的运动。

运动估计可以减少帧间差异,从而有效地压缩视频数据。

变换编码主要利用了离散余弦变换(Discrete Cosine Transform,简称DCT)来将时域数据转换为频域数据。

通过对频域数据进行量化和编码,可以进一步减小视频数据的体积。

最后,H.264使用了基于Huffman编码的熵编码来进一步压缩数据。

熵编码通过对常出现的模式进行编码来减小数据传输所需的比特数。

总体来说,H.264编码算法在提供较高视频质量的同时,能够有效地压缩视频数据,减少传输和存储所需的带宽和空间。

二、HEVC编码算法HEVC是高效视频编码(High Efficiency Video Coding,简称HEVC)的缩写。

它是H.264的继任者,采用了更先进的压缩技术,能够提供更高质量的视频并进一步减小数据的体积。

与H.264相比,HEVC在帧内和帧间预测、运动估计、变换编码和熵编码等方面进行了改进和优化。

例如,HEVC引入了一种新的预测模式,称为HEVC中的变换单元(Transform Unit,简称TU),可以进一步提高帧内和帧间的预测精度。

多媒体技术视频与编码标准

多媒体技术视频与编码标准

多媒体技术视频与编码标准多媒体技术是指以数字技术作为基础,通过图像、声音、视频等多种媒体形式的集成展示方式。

而编码标准则是为了在传输和存储过程中将多媒体数据进行压缩和解压缩的一种方法。

多媒体技术在现代社会中的应用非常广泛,从电视广播、电影制作到在线视频、游戏、虚拟现实等领域,都离不开多媒体技术的支持。

而编码标准则起到了优化多媒体数据传输和存储的作用,使得多媒体内容能够以更高效、更稳定的方式呈现给用户。

目前,常用的视频编码标准包括MPEG-2、H.264/AVC和HEVC(H.265)。

MPEG-2是最早的数字视频编码标准之一,广泛应用于DVD和数字电视广播。

H.264/AVC是当前最主流的视频编码标准,被广泛应用于在线视频平台和高清电视广播。

而HEVC是最新的视频编码标准,相较于H.264/AVC,具有更好的压缩性能,能够提供更高质量的视频内容。

在多媒体技术中,音频编码标准也是不可或缺的一部分。

常见的音频编码标准包括MP3、AAC和Opus。

MP3是最早流行起来的音频编码标准,它能够在较小的文件大小下保持相对较高的音质。

AAC是一种高级音频编码标准,通常用于音乐和音频流媒体传输。

而Opus是一种适用于各种应用领域的新一代开放式音频编码标准,具有较高的音质和较低的延迟。

在多媒体技术中,还有许多其他编码标准被应用于图像、文字和其他类型的多媒体数据。

例如,JPEG是一种常用的图像编码标准,用于压缩静态图像。

MP4、AVI等是常用的多媒体容器格式,可以包含视频、音频和文本等不同类型的多媒体数据。

总结来说,多媒体技术与编码标准密不可分。

多媒体技术通过利用编码标准对多媒体数据进行压缩和解压缩,实现了高效的传输和存储。

随着技术的不断进步,多媒体技术和编码标准也在不断发展,为用户提供更好的观看和体验体验。

多媒体技术的发展已经成为现代社会不可或缺的一部分。

从电影到电视广播,从网络直播到游戏,多媒体技术为人们提供了丰富多样的视听娱乐体验。

高效视频编码标准中的关键技术概述-精品文档

高效视频编码标准中的关键技术概述-精品文档

高效视频编码标准中的关键技术概述一、HEVC编码框架HEVC仍然沿用了H.261就开始采用的基于运动补偿的混合编码框架,即帧间和帧内预测用于消除时间域和空间域的相关性;对预测残差进行离散余弦变换和量化以消除空间相关性;自适应熵编码消除统计冗余;环路滤波用于消除量化噪声,但HEVC 在图像编码单元组织、内容自适应算术编码、多方向帧内预测、先进运动矢量预测和合并、分像素运动估计与补偿、自适应像素补偿和环路滤波等方面都做了很大的改进。

HEVC的主要技术特征如下:(一)树形编码块结构在HEVC 中,基本编码单元为编码树单元CTU,大小为16×16、32×32或者64×64,每个编码树单元由亮度编码树块与对应的色度编码树块组成。

每个编码树块可以进一步分成编码块CB,根据预测与变换的率失真性能,可以对编码块进一步的分成预测块PB和变换块TB。

编码块、预测块和变换块的分离使视频编码更加灵活,各种不同的划分组合更能适应视频图像的纹理特征,有助于编码效率的提高。

(二)四叉树残差变换块结构残差四叉树变换属于一种自适应的变换技术,是对H.264/MPEGAVC中自适应块变换ABT技术的延伸和扩展。

它允许变换块的大小能够根据预测残差的特征进行自适应的选择,在残差能量集中、图像细节保留以及图像三者之间最优均衡。

(三)自适应样点补偿自适应样点补偿是一个自适应选择过程,在编解码环路内,位于去块滤波(Deblock)之后。

若使用SAO技术,重构图像将按照递归的方式分裂成4个子区域,每个子区域将根据其图像像素特征选择一种像素补偿方式,以减少源图像与重构图像之间的失真,从而提高压缩率,减少码流。

采用SAO后,平均码流减少了2%~6%,但编解码器的性能消耗只增加了约2%。

目前有两大类补偿方式:带状补偿和边缘补偿。

带状补偿:将像素值强度等级划分为若干个条带,每个条带内的像素拥有相同的补偿值。

进行补偿时根据重构像素点所处的条带,选择相应的带状补偿值进行补偿。

视频编码标准的选择与优化分析

视频编码标准的选择与优化分析

视频编码标准的选择与优化分析随着互联网和数字化技术的快速发展,视频的应用已经变得无处不在。

而视频编码技术的发展与创新,对于视频的质量和传输效率起着至关重要的作用。

在选择适合自己需求的视频编码标准时,需要考虑到视频质量、传输效率、实时性和设备兼容性等多个方面因素,并进行相应的优化分析。

一、视频编码标准的选择1. H.264/AVCH.264/AVC是当前广泛应用的视频编码标准之一,它优化了传输效率和视频质量的平衡。

它具备较好的压缩效果,在相同比特率下,能够提供更高的视频质量。

同时,H.264/AVC还具备广泛的设备兼容性,可以在各种终端设备上进行播放。

因此,对于大多数应用场景来说,选择H.264/AVC是一个较为明智的选择。

2. H.265/HEVCH.265/HEVC是H.264/AVC的升级版,它在压缩效率上有了显著的改进。

相同质量下,H.265/HEVC能够以更低的比特率进行传输,从而节省网络带宽。

然而,由于H.265/HEVC相对于H.264/AVC的算法更复杂,编解码的计算复杂度更高,因此对于传输设备要求较高,可能会增加硬件成本。

因此,在选择H.265/HEVC时需要综合考虑硬件设备和压缩效率之间的平衡。

3. VP9VP9是由Google开发的开源视频编码标准,具备出色的视频质量和压缩效率。

VP9在Google的产品中广泛应用,比如YouTube的视频播放。

然而,VP9的设备兼容性较差,只能在部分设备上进行播放,因此在选择时需要考虑到具体的应用场景。

4. AV1AV1是由Alliance for Open Media开发的最新开源视频编码标准,它综合了前几种编码标准的优点。

AV1具备极高的压缩效率和出色的视频质量,可以在超高清视频和4K视频等高清视频领域中发挥出色的效果。

然而,由于AV1是最新的标准,设备兼容性还不够成熟,可能会面临一些技术挑战和兼容性问题。

二、视频编码标准的优化分析1. 码率控制码率控制是视频编码中的一个重要环节,它决定了视频的压缩比例和传输效率。

高清视频编码技术研究及应用

高清视频编码技术研究及应用

高清视频编码技术研究及应用随着移动互联网的普及,越来越多的人开始使用智能手机、平板电脑等移动设备观看视频。

高清视频的流畅播放就成为了移动设备使用体验的重要标准之一。

而高清视频编码技术的发展则是实现流畅播放的关键。

一、高清视频编码技术的发展历程在1995年,MPEG-1视频标准被制定出来,这也是第一代视频压缩标准。

虽然MPEG-1可以实现视频的压缩,但由于其压缩比较低,所以只适合对低分辨率和低帧率的视频进行压缩。

MPEG-2标准是第二代视频压缩标准,是为了适应数字电视广播而推出的。

MPEG-2能够压缩高清视频,支持多个音频信道和字幕流输入,被广泛应用在数字电视、DVD和蓝光光盘等领域。

而H.264/AVC标准则是近几年来业界广泛使用的第三代视频压缩标准。

H.264/AVC标准采用了更先进的编码算法,能够实现高压缩比和高质量视频的编码。

同时,H.264/AVC标准也支持多个分辨率和帧率,适用于网络视频、手机视频等多种应用场景。

二、高清视频编码技术的现状目前,H.264/AVC仍然是使用最广泛的视频编码标准。

但由于高清视频的码率和数据量较大,对系统硬件的要求较高,因此需要在编码器和解码器上进行优化。

在编码器方面,采用更先进的处理器、更高效的调度算法、更科学的数据预处理等技术可以提高编码效率。

例如,利用并行计算技术,可以有效地加速编码进程,降低编码延迟和复杂度。

在解码器方面,也需要采用更快速的处理器、更高效的内存读写、更科学的数据缓存等技术。

与编码器相似,利用并行计算技术也可以有效地加速解码进程,降低解码延迟和复杂度。

三、高清视频编码技术的应用目前,高清视频编码技术已经广泛应用在各个领域。

以下是一些典型案例:1. 网络视频随着各种在线视频平台的兴起,网络视频已经成为人们获取信息和娱乐的重要渠道。

而高清视频能够提供更好的观看体验,因此越来越多的网络视频平台开始推广高清视频。

2. 视频通信高清视频编码技术也被广泛应用于视频通信领域,例如视频会议、视频监控等。

新一代视频编码标准

新一代视频编码标准

新一代视频编码标准随着科技的不断发展,视频编码标准也在不断更新换代。

新一代视频编码标准的出现,将会对视频行业产生深远的影响。

本文将对新一代视频编码标准进行介绍,并探讨其对视频产业的影响。

新一代视频编码标准,主要是指H.265/HEVC(High Efficiency Video Coding)标准。

相较于之前的H.264/AVC标准,H.265/HEVC标准具有更高的压缩比和更好的视频质量,在相同画质下能够减少一半的码率。

这意味着在同样的带宽下,用户可以观看到更清晰、更流畅的视频内容。

这对于视频网站、在线直播、视频会议等行业来说,将会带来更好的用户体验,提升整个行业的竞争力。

除了提高视频质量外,新一代视频编码标准还将对视频产业的存储和传输产生重大影响。

由于H.265/HEVC标准具有更高的压缩比,相同画质的视频文件大小将会更小,这意味着在相同存储空间下能够存储更多的视频内容。

对于视频网站和在线视频平台来说,这将降低存储成本,提升存储效率。

同时,在传输方面,由于H.265/HEVC标准能够以更低的码率传输相同画质的视频内容,将会减少带宽占用,提高视频传输的稳定性和速度。

新一代视频编码标准的出现,也将对视频设备产业带来影响。

由于H.265/HEVC标准的普及,未来的智能手机、平板电脑、电视等设备将会更好地支持高清、超高清的视频内容。

这将推动视频设备产业的升级,提高设备的竞争力和市场需求。

总的来看,新一代视频编码标准的出现,将会对视频产业产生深远的影响。

它将提升视频质量,降低存储成本,提高视频传输效率,推动视频设备产业的发展。

这将为视频产业带来更多的发展机遇和挑战,也将为用户带来更好的观看体验。

相信随着新一代视频编码标准的不断普及,视频产业将会迎来新的发展机遇,迎接更美好的未来。

设计并实现一种高效的视频编码算法

设计并实现一种高效的视频编码算法

设计并实现一种高效的视频编码算法视频编码算法是视频编码领域中的核心技术之一,它能够将视频信号转换为数字编码形式并压缩,从而减少数据传输的带宽和存储容量。

高效的视频编码算法可以大大提高视频传输的质量和速度。

本文将介绍一种设计并实现一种高效的视频编码算法的方法。

一、研究视频编码原理在进行视频编码算法研究之前,我们需要了解视频编码的原理。

视频编码基于图像编码,其核心思想是利用信号的冗余性和相关性来压缩数据。

基本的视频编码方法包括运动估计、离散余弦变换、量化和熵编码等步骤。

- 运动估计运动估计是视频编码中的关键步骤,它通过分析相邻帧之间的运动信息来压缩视频数据。

在运动估计中,通过将当前帧与前一帧进行比较,判断当前帧中哪些像素与前一帧中的像素相同或近似,从而获得预测图像。

通过对预测图像和实际图像之间的误差进行编码,可以减少数据传输量。

- 离散余弦变换离散余弦变换是一种将时域信号变换为频域信号的方法,它可以消除信号中的冗余和相关性。

在视频编码中,采用二维离散余弦变换对图像进行编码。

- 量化量化是视频编码中的一种数据压缩方法,它将变换后的系数进行分组并缩放,使得放弃部分数据后对图像的影响尽可能的小。

- 熵编码熵编码是一种基于信源统计规律的编码方法,可以通过对视频数据中出现最频繁的符号进行编码实现数据压缩。

二、设计一个基于H.264标准的高效视频编码算法H.264是一种广泛使用的视频编码标准,它基于广泛使用的MPEG-4标准,极大地提高了视频编码的效率和质量。

本文设计并实现一种基于H.264标准的高效视频编码算法。

- 运动估计在运动估计中,算法将当前帧分为若干宏块,对于每个宏块,通过检测其在前一帧中的位置来判断其运动信息。

为了实现更精确的运动估计,本算法采用全搜索法代替传统的四叉树搜索法。

- 变换与量化在本算法中,对图像使用8x8像素块的离散余弦变换,将系数量化到特定的量化等级。

- 熵编码采用自适应变长编码算法,使更频繁的符号具有更短的编码长度。

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
相关文档
最新文档